Dennis B. Hauenstein

Jun 19, 1950 — Jul 21, 2026

Dennis B Hauenstein, 76, of Columbus, Ohio, peacefully passed away with his family by his side on July 21, 2026. He was born in 1950 in Massillon, Ohio to Donald and Mary (Andrichs) Hauenstein, Sr.

Dennis graduated from The Ohio State University and had a fulfilling career first in accounting and then facilities management. Dennis came from an industrious family and carried that practical, hands-on spirit throughout his life. He enjoyed learning how things worked and taking on projects, whether they involved technology, plumbing, home repairs, or another problem that called for patience and persistence. An active member of several prayer groups at Grace Polaris Church, Dennis had a deep faith in God.

Family was his first priority and he played a significant role in raising eight children. He would drop everything to help others and showed love through acts of service to those around him. His love of animals was second only to his family. Over the years he cared for dozens of pets and spent countless hours bird watching and enjoying time in nature.

Dennis was preceded in death by his parents; his brothers Donald, Jr and John; and his sisters Sharon (Harwig) and Carol Ann. He is survived by his wife of 27 years, Jennifer; children, Nathan, Sally, and Jennifer "Annie"; stepchildren Michael Murtha, Mary Kate (Joshua) Hunt, Colleen (Ben) Scarbro, Kristine (Alen Mlatisuma) Powers, Erin (Marc) Stitt; and 9 grandchildren.

Calling hours will be held on August 1, 2026, from 10:00 to 11:00 am with a memorial service and luncheon immediately following at Christian Community Church, 5586 Olentangy River Road, Columbus, Ohio.

In lieu of flowers, memorial contributions may be made to the Mid-Ohio Food Collective to honor his desire to serve the local community and help those in need (www.mofc.org).
